Maximizing Your Social ROI: How To Measure Success In The Digital Age

In today’s digital age, businesses are constantly seeking new ways to measure the success of their marketing efforts One key metric that has gained popularity in recent years is social return on investment (ROI) Social ROI refers to the return on investment that a company gets from its social media activities This metric can help businesses evaluate the effectiveness of their social media campaigns and determine whether they are achieving their marketing goals.

Social media has become an essential tool for businesses looking to connect with customers, build brand awareness, and drive sales With the rise of social media platforms such as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ter, companies have more opportunities than ever to reach their target audience and engage with them on a personal level However, many businesses struggle to measure the impact of their social media efforts and determine whether they are getting a positive return on their investment.

Measuring social ROI can be a challenging task, as there are many different variables that can influence the success of a social media campaign However, there are several key metrics that businesses can use to evaluate the effectiveness of their social media efforts and determine their social ROI.

One of the most important metrics for measuring social ROI is engagement Engagement refers to the level of interaction that users have with a company’s social media content, such as likes, shares, comments, and clicks High levels of engagement indicate that users are interested in the company’s content and are likely to become loyal customers.

Another important metric for measuring social ROI is reach Reach refers to the number of people who see a company’s social media content social roi. A high reach indicates that a company’s content is being seen by a large audience, which can help to increase brand awareness and drive sales.

In addition to engagement and reach, businesses can also track conversions to measure their social ROI Conversions refer to the actions that users take after interacting with a company’s social media content, such as making a purchase, signing up for a newsletter, or filling out a contact form By tracking conversions, businesses can determine the impact that their social media campaigns are having on their bottom line.

To calculate social ROI, businesses can use a formula that takes into account the cost of their social media efforts and the return that they are getting from those efforts By comparing the cost of their social media campaigns to the revenue that they generate from those campaigns, businesses can determine whether they are getting a positive return on their investment.

There are also a number of tools available that can help businesses track their social ROI more effectively These tools can provide detailed analytics on key metrics such as engagement, reach, and conversions, allowing businesses to track the success of their social media campaigns in real time.
